2 PER CURIAM:
Mike Anthony Richardson appeals the district court’s
order denying relief on his 42 U.S.C. § 1983 (2006) complaint.
We have reviewed the record and find no reversible error.
Accordingly, we affirm for the reasons stated by the district
court. Richardson v. Captain Gray, No. 4:08-cv-03539-RBH
(D.S.C. Nov. 19, 2010). We deny Richardson’s motions to appoint
counsel and for a transcript at government expense and dispense
with oral argument because the facts and legal contentions are
adequately presented in the materials before the court and
argument would not aid the decisional process.
AFFIRMED
